Chrome浏览器2025年开发者模式调试操作技巧教程
发布时间:2026-02-28
来源:谷歌浏览器官网

一、准备阶段
1. 安装Chrome浏览器:确保你的计算机上已经安装了最新版本的Chrome浏览器。
2. 启用开发者工具:在Chrome浏览器的菜单栏中,点击“更多工具”>“扩展程序”,然后点击“开发者工具”。这将打开一个包含多种工具的窗口。
3. 创建新项目:在开发者工具窗口中,点击右上角的“新建”按钮,选择“无头”或“无主标签页”选项,以便在不启动浏览器的情况下进行调试。
二、进入开发者模式
1. 访问网站:在地址栏中输入你想要调试的网站URL,然后按回车键访问该网站。
2. 打开开发者工具:当你看到开发者工具窗口时,点击其中的“检查”按钮,或者按下快捷键`Ctrl + Shift + I`(Windows/Linux)或`Cmd + Opt + I`(Mac)。这将打开一个新的选项卡,其中包含了所有可用的开发者工具。
三、使用开发者工具
1. 控制台:点击“控制台”按钮,将显示当前页面的所有JavaScript错误和警告。你可以在这里添加代码来调试。
2. 元素:点击“元素”按钮,将显示页面上的所有HTML、CSS和JavaScript元素。你可以使用这些信息来定位和修改页面内容。
3. 网络:点击“网络”按钮,将显示页面加载过程中的网络请求和响应数据。你可以通过调整这些数据来优化页面性能。
4. 资源:点击“资源”按钮,将显示页面上的所有图像、字体和其他资源文件。你可以使用这些信息来优化页面加载速度。
5. 设置:点击“设置”按钮,将打开一个包含各种选项的面板,如断点、时间轴等。你可以使用这些功能来自定义调试过程。
6. 历史记录:点击“历史记录”按钮,将打开一个包含所有历史记录的列表。你可以使用这个列表来查看和修改页面的历史状态。
7. 存储:点击“存储”按钮,将打开一个包含所有存储数据的列表。你可以使用这个列表来查看和修改页面的存储状态。
8. 监视:点击“监视”按钮,将打开一个包含所有监视变量的列表。你可以使用这个列表来查看和修改页面的监视变量。
9. 调试:点击“调试”按钮,将打开一个包含所有调试信息的列表。你可以使用这个列表来查看和修改页面的调试信息。
10. 设置断点:在代码行中点击,然后按`F5`键(Windows/Linux)或`Cmd+Shift+F5`(Mac)来设置断点。当代码执行到断点处时,浏览器会暂停执行并显示一个对话框,让你可以查看和修改变量的值。
四、高级技巧
1. 使用XHR:通过“网络”面板中的“XHR”选项卡,你可以查看和修改XHR请求和响应的数据。这有助于优化页面的性能和用户体验。
2. 使用Console API:通过“控制台”面板中的“Console API”选项卡,你可以使用JavaScript编写自定义的函数和命令来控制开发者工具的行为。
3. 使用Sources:通过“资源”面板中的“Sources”选项卡,你可以查看和修改页面上的资源文件,如图片、字体等。
4. 使用Timeline:通过“时间轴”面板,你可以查看和修改页面的加载时间和渲染时间,从而优化页面的性能和用户体验。
5. 使用Debugger:通过“调试”面板,你可以使用断点、单步执行等功能来逐步调试代码,从而更好地理解代码的逻辑和行为。
6. 使用Profiler:通过“性能”面板,你可以查看和修改页面的加载时间和渲染时间,从而优化页面的性能和用户体验。
7. 使用Memory:通过“内存”面板,你可以查看和修改页面的内存使用情况,从而优化页面的性能和用户体验。
8. 使用Network:通过“网络”面板,你可以查看和修改页面的网络请求和响应数据,从而优化页面的性能和用户体验。
9. 使用Storage:通过“存储”面板,你可以查看和修改页面的存储数据,从而优化页面的性能和用户体验。
10. 使用监视:通过“监视”面板,你可以查看和修改页面的监视变量,从而优化页面的性能和用户体验。
11. 使用断点:通过“设置断点”功能,你可以在代码行中设置断点,以便在代码执行到断点处时暂停执行并查看和修改变量的值。
12. 使用调试:通过“调试”功能,你可以在代码行中设置断点,并在代码执行到断点处时暂停执行并查看和修改变量的值。
13. 使用XHR:通过“网络”面板中的“XHR”选项卡,你可以查看和修改XHR请求和响应的数据,从而优化页面的性能和用户体验。
14. 使用Console API:通过“控制台”面板中的“Console API”选项卡,你可以使用JavaScript编写自定义的函数和命令来控制开发者工具的行为。
15. 使用Sources:通过“资源”面板中的“Sources”选项卡,你可以查看和修改页面上的资源文件,如图片、字体等。
16. 使用Timeline:通过“时间轴”面板,你可以查看和修改页面的加载时间和渲染时间,从而优化页面的性能和用户体验。
17. 使用Debugger:通过“调试”面板,你可以使用断点、单步执行等功能来逐步调试代码,从而更好地理解代码的逻辑和行为。
18. 使用Profiler:通过“性能”面板,你可以查看和修改页面的加载时间和渲染时间,从而优化页面的性能和用户体验。
19. 使用Memory:通过“内存”面板,你可以查看和修改页面的内存使用情况,从而优化页面的性能和用户体验。
20. 使用Network:通过“网络”面板,你可以查看和修改页面的网络请求和响应数据,从而优化页面的性能和用户体验。
21. 使用Storage:通过“存储”面板,你可以查看和修改页面的存储数据,从而优化页面的性能和用户体验。
22. 使用监视:通过“监视”面板,你可以查看和修改页面的监视变量,从而优化页面的性能和用户体验。
23. 使用断点:通过“设置断点”功能,你可以在代码行中设置断点,并在代码执行到断点处时暂停执行并查看和修改变量的值。
24. 使用调试:通过“调试”功能,你可以在代码行中设置断点,并在代码执行到断点处时暂停执行并查看和修改变量的值。
25. 使用XHR:通过“网络”面板中的“XHR”选项卡,你可以查看和修改XHR请求和响应的数据,从而优化页面的性能和用户体验。
26. 使用Console API:通过“控制台”面板中的“Console API”选项卡,你可以使用JavaScript编写自定义的函数和命令来控制开发者工具的行为。
27. 使用Sources:通过“资源”面板中的“Sources”选项卡,你可以查看和修改页面上的资源文件,如图片、字体等。
28. 使用Timeline:通过“时间轴”面板,你可以查看和修改页面的加载时间和渲染时间,从而优化页面的性能和用户体验。
29. 使用Debugger:通过“调试”面板,你可以使用断点、单步执行等功能来逐步调试代码,从而更好地理解代码的逻辑和行为。
30. 使用Profiler:通过“性能”面板,你可以查看和修改页面的加载时间和渲染时间,从而优化页面的性能和用户体验。
31. 使用Memory:通过“内存”面板,你可以查看和修改页面的内存使用情况,从而优化页面的性能和用户体验。
32. 使用Network:通过“网络”面板,你可以查看和修改页面的网络请求和响应数据,从而优化页面的性能和用户体验。
33. 使用Storage:通过“存储”面板,你可以查看和修改页面的存储数据,从而优化页面的性能和用户体验。
34. 使用监视:通过“监视”面板,你可以查看和修改页面的监视变量,从而优化页面的性能和用户体验。
35. 使用断点:通过“设置断点”功能,你可以在代码行中设置断点,并在代码执行到断点处时暂停执行并查看和修改变量的值。
36. 使用调试:通过“调试”功能,你可以在代码行中设置断点,并在代码执行到断点处时暂停执行并查看和修改变量的值。
37. 使用XHR:通过“网络”面板中的“XHR”选项卡,你可以查看和修改XHR请求和响应的数据,从而优化页面的性能和用户体验。
38. 使用Console API:通过“控制台”面板中的“Console API”选项卡,你可以使用JavaScript编写自定义的函数和命令来控制开发者工具的行为。
39. 使用Sources:通过“资源”面板中的“Sources”选项卡,你可以查看和修改页面上的资源文件,如图片、字体等。
40. 使用Timeline:通过“时间轴”面板,你可以查看和修改页面的加载时间和渲染时间,从而优化页面的性能和用户体验。
41. 使用Debugger:通过“调试”面板,你可以使用断点、单步执行等功能来逐步调试代码,从而更好地理解代码的逻辑和行为。
42. 使用Profiler:通过“性能”面板,你可以查看和修改页面的加载时间和渲染时间,从而优化页面的性能和用户体验。
43. 使用Memory:通过“内存”面板,你可以查看和修改页面的内存使用情况,从而优化页面的性能和用户体验。
44. 使用Network:通过“网络”面板,你可以查看和修改页面的网络请求和响应数据,从而优化页面的性能和用户体验。
45. 使用Storage:通过“存储”面板,你可以查看和修改页面的存储数据,从而优化页面的性能和用户体验。
46. 使用监视:通过“监视”面板,你可以查看和修改页面的监视变量,从而优化页面的性能和用户体验。
47. 使用断点:通过“设置断点”功能,你可以在代码行中设置断点,并在代码执行到断点处时暂停执行并查看和修改变量的值。
48. 使用调试:通过“调试”功能,你可以在代码行中设置断点,并在代码执行到断点处时暂停执行并查看和修改变量的值。
49. 使用XHR:通过“网络”面板中的“XHR”选项卡,你可以查看和修改XHR请求和响应的数据,从而优化页面的性能和用户体验。
50. 使用Console API:通过“控制台”面板中的“Console API”选项卡,你可以使用JavaScript编写自定义的函数和命令来控制开发者工具的行为。